Nice one Duane, no more than what I would expect from you. (In fact, quite a bit less than I think you're capable of! If you can regularly hit around 900rpm more than me with the Plastic then I feel you should be 800-900 more than me with the Metal.)
Stick with it and I'm sure you'll see results. Why not try what I did the first time I hit 13k? I'd done lots of Plastic 30s runs where I tried to keep the Powerball at 13k, no more, no less. Then I did lots of Plastic speed runs where I tried to hit 13k. Just so I knew what it felt like and what it sounded like. Then I picked up the Metal and tried to replicate the action exactly, and it only took me four or five attempts to see 13k flashing on the Metal's counter!
Do that with the Plastic, only aim to hold it at nearer 14k, (though perhaps not for 30 seconds - at least for as long as you can), and then see what happens with the Metal.

I'm curious to know a few things: First, how much do you do with your left hand in a session like that? I'm talking about percentage of warm-up time on that hand, and the number of speed runs you do as well.
Secondly, approximately how much resting time do you spend on average between speed runs, and do you mix in some short endurace during hot mode?
This session was all with the right hand. I warmed up with one 30s run on the 250Hz and then went straight into successive speed runs alternating between the Metal and the 250Hz on after another. I took about only a few seconds in between runs, probably long enough to stop the recording, save the video file and reset the Powerballalyzer and the webcam again.
My first few (three?) attempts with the 250Hz were around 14700 and with the metal they were at 12900, but soon I went above both 15K on the 250Hz and 13K on the Metal. I only did speed runs as this is currently where I want to get some new records. I stayed at this level until I began to tire in my fingers a little, and I decided to stop. I was still above 15k on the plastic and 13k on the Metal when I ended the session.
It was my first session in about a week's time. I have only been doing once a week sessions lately. I am trying to keep my scores above 15k / 13k marks with only one session a week until I am ready to switch to a more rigorous training pattern again.
